We've been using Beyond since launch. We own multiple books (on Beyond), and the PHB is certainly one of them. He joined the campaign (on Beyond) and is ironing out his character. However, he cannot see the Charlatan background. I, on the other hand, click on his character, click the builder and look at his backgrounds and I DO see all the backgrounds available. All of our content is shared, and out of the 5 or so different campaigns we've done on Beyond, this is the first time something like this is occurring.
Any suggestions as to why this player can't see those options?
You and he should both use this link to ensure that your respective Account Entitlements are in sync: (https://www.dndbeyond.com/account/marketplace). If that’s not the problem try turning your content sharing off and back on again.
We just figured it out, he somehow was on his character's editing pages but his session must have timed out or something. He wasn't logged in anymore, but was accessing his edit pages. Upon logging in it worked out. Thanks for answering.
I've had this happen before (more than once) when a player joins a campaign and cant see shared content, but the DM can.
I think it is a caching or cookie issue. It always fixes itself eventually. It can probably be fixed faster by turning sharing off and on again, but haven't had opportunity to try that.
